-//////////////////////////////////////////////////////////////////////////////// |
-// Widget class |
-// |
-// Encapsulates the platform-specific rendering, event receiving and widget |
-// management aspects of the UI framework. |
-// |
-// Owns a RootView and thus a View hierarchy. Can contain child Widgets. |
-// Widget is a platform-independent type that communicates with a platform or |
-// context specific NativeWidget implementation. |
-// |
-// A special note on ownership: |
-// |
-// Depending on the value of the InitParams' ownership field, the Widget |
-// either owns or is owned by its NativeWidget: |
-// |
-// ownership = NATIVE_WIDGET_OWNS_WIDGET (default) |
-// The Widget instance is owned by its NativeWidget. When the NativeWidget |
-// is destroyed (in response to a native destruction message), it deletes |
-// the Widget from its destructor. |
-// ownership = WIDGET_OWNS_NATIVE_WIDGET (non-default) |
-// The Widget instance owns its NativeWidget. This state implies someone |
-// else wants to control the lifetime of this object. When they destroy |
-// the Widget it is responsible for destroying the NativeWidget (from its |
-// destructor). |
-// |
